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
85964749972 8600648 3771238
087322 61852 362940741
087322 61852 362940741
2155506 65731895 9718120095
All about undefined
Interested in learning more?
087322 61852 362940741
2155506 65731895 9718120095
See more
1914132 665611396 74255977090
119641897 491 33344006
See more
7756428710 78223000333
20 386555 36516 14495
See more